A private ADHD assessment lets you be diagnosed by an expert and receive treatment. The process is usually fairly extensive and involves a lengthy interview with a psychiatrist and often the need to bring reports from school. The psychiatrist will also need to confirm whether your symptoms are present since the time you were a child. This is a challenge for older adults who can diagnosis adhd might not have access to their previous school records. The psychiatric doctor will also examine any family history of mental health issues and search for any co-morbidities such as depression or anxiety, which are very common in ADHD.

Private providers can provide ADHD assessments through Skype or over the phone. This can be a great option for those living far away from the best clinics in the UK. This type of assessment can be less expensive and quicker than an NHS Maudsley Referral. However it is crucial to keep in mind that a private evaluation doesn't mean that you will automatically be prescribed medication. Many GPs will refuse to sign a 'shared care agreement' with patients who have been diagnosed privately, particularly in the event that they haven't been properly titrated to the correct dosage of medication.

It can take a long time to get an ADHD diagnosis adult adhd. You'll have to go through an appointment with a psychiatrist, and then undergo a thorough assessment. The psychiatrist will examine your current issues as well as the ones you experienced in childhood. He or she will also ask for some supporting evidence, such as old school reports. The psychiatrist will determine if your ADHD symptoms result in significant impairment. The psychiatrist will also look into your comorbidity. This is a reference to any other mental disorders.

The diagnosis takes about 2 hours minimum. Your doctor will evaluate you for each of the three major traits of ADHD: inattentiveness, hyperactivity and impulsivity. The doctor will use these tests to determine if you meet the ADHD criteria. Some people with ADHD display all three traits while others display a mix of symptoms.
